JAKARTA, KOMPAS— The government has decided to impose large-scale social restrictions (PSBB) to prevent the spread of COVID-19 in Indonesia. However, technical guidelines, such as the criteria and procedures for the enactment, are being drafted by the Health Ministry.

Due to the absence of the guidelines, regional governments have issued their own policies related to social restrictions. The government’s appeals to the public to not travel to their hometowns during Idul Fitri to prevent the spread of COVID-19 in the regions have also not been fully complied with due to the absence of clear guidelines on the implementation of the policy.
